Our herd has been started from some great dairy herds:  Echo Hills, Blue Oaks, Green Gables, Blackberry’s BMM, and Jardine Meadows.  We have F-4, F-5, and F-7 generation does with great markings.  The Miniature Dairy Goat Association (MDGA) describes the Mini Nubian as “a graceful dairy goat of mixed Asian, African and European origin, known for high quality, high butterfat milk production and the Nigerian Dwarf”.
